What is a passkey authentication provider?
A passkey authentication provider is a vendor that supplies the certified infrastructure (APIs, SDKs, and an attestation/credential backend) for registering and verifying FIDO2/WebAuthn passkeys on behalf of an application. Instead of building and maintaining a WebAuthn server, key storage, device attestation, and recovery flows in-house, a business integrates the provider and lets users sign in with a biometric or device PIN. Because the private key never leaves the user's device and there is no shared secret to phish, passkeys are phishing-resistant by design. What does a passkey authentication provider actually do?
It operates the certified server side of FIDO2/WebAuthn so you don't have to. The provider handles credential registration, public-key verification of authentication assertions, device attestation, account recovery, and the cross-platform plumbing for syncing and roaming passkeys, exposed as APIs and SDKs you call from your app and backend.
Why use a provider instead of building passkeys in-house?
WebAuthn is an open standard, but a production deployment requires a correctly implemented relying-party server, secure credential storage, attestation handling, fallback and recovery flows, and ongoing conformance as browsers and platforms evolve. A FIDO2-certified provider ships all of that pre-built and maintained, cutting integration from quarters to days while removing a class of subtle security bugs.
What makes a passkey provider phishing-resistant?
Passkeys use public-key cryptography and are bound to the origin (domain) they were created for. There is no password or one-time passcode to enter, so there is nothing for an attacker to phish, replay, or intercept, and a credential cannot be used on a look-alike site. This meets the bar for phishing-resistant multi-factor authentication and aligns with NIST AAL2 guidance.
What should you look for in a passkey authentication provider?
FIDO2 certification, support for NIST AAL2 and (for payments) PSD2 Strong Customer Authentication, broad device and browser coverage, drop-in SDKs with minimal backend changes, and, increasingly, the ability to authenticate AI agents acting on a user's behalf with scoped, signed, revocable consent.

- Are passkeys more secure than passwords and OTPs?
- Yes. Passwords and SMS/app one-time passcodes rely on shared secrets that can be phished, intercepted, or breached. Passkeys use device-bound public-key cryptography with no shared secret and are bound to the legitimate origin, removing the most common account-takeover attack vectors.
